Overview
Enjoy a deeper and richer experience of Manuel Antonio National Park than would be possible visiting alone. This small-group guided tour lets you discover the park's remarkable biodiversity. Your guide's expert eyes will find even the best-camouflaged creatures and they will provide a spotting scope for close-up views of monkeys, tropical birds, and more.
- Visit with a guide for a richer experience of Manuel Antonio National Park
- Get close-up views of wildlife in its native habitat
- Small-group tour (maximum eight guests): A more personalized experience
- Hassle-free pickup from your Quepo accommodations

One of the best parks in CR for wildlife
Luiza_C
, Aug 2021
This was by far one of my two favorite national park tours in Costa Rica. While in some parks the zip lines scare away a lot of the animals, in this one, we saw something new every few feet (despite there being quite a few people on the large trail). We had a fantastic guide also who was extremely knowledgable about the various species we encountered. Saw many kids on the trail so this is also child friendly. Towards the end, you have an option to either stay on the beautiful beach or continue the trail outside of the park (easy to do on own). There is absolutely no food allowed on the trail, but there's a restaurant and giftshop in the park towards end of trail, right before the beach.
And of course the monkeys were everywhere : )
Get a guide if you go, but not worth the trip
Robert_H
, Apr 2021
Our guide Marvin was fantastic, but we were very disappointed that we saw very few animals. On our two hour tour he pointed out three sloths, a few birds, an iguana, a spider, and a few frogs. To be clear, we wouldn't have seen any if not for Marvin. He used a scope to spot things we couldn't see with the naked eye. But between the new(ish) policy not allowing food in the park and the dearth of visitors during Covid, the animals no longer have any incentive to hang out near the few miles of visitor. I totally understand that it's better for the animals, but in my opinion the trip across the country to Manuel Antonio is no longer worth the effort.
